It was a great time to go\u2014the end of the rainy season meant everything was lush and green, there was plenty of water, and fewer crowds. The weather was fantastic.<\/span><\/em><\/p>\n<p><em><span style=\"font-family: arial, helvetica, sans-serif; color: #800000; font-size: 14pt;\">We started our trip in Arusha; our guide picked us up at the airport, and we headed straight for our first safari in Tarangire National Park. It was amazing\u2014loads of elephants, as well as giraffes, ostriches, antelopes, and birds. The scenery is beautiful. From there, we went to Lake Manyara. The landscape was gorgeous and completely different from what we had seen before. We saw fewer animals there, but we still spotted buffalo, elephants, baboons, vervet monkeys, and the tops of hippos&#8217; heads. Our next stop was the Serengeti; on the way, we passed through Ngorongoro and took a walk with a view overlooking the crater.<\/span><\/em><\/p>\n<p><em><span style=\"font-family: arial, helvetica, sans-serif; color: #800000; font-size: 14pt;\">Then we arrived in the <a href=\"https:\/\/whc.unesco.org\/en\/list\/156\/\">Serengeti<\/a>\u2014it was a marvel. The landscapes and the sheer number of animals were incredible; we saw lions, a leopard, a cheetah, hippos (both in and out of the water), giraffes, and millions upon millions of wildebeest and zebras. The Serengeti is indescribable; it is an experience you simply have to enjoy. But the icing on the cake was still to come: the Ngorongoro Crater. It is so beautiful! The landscape with its vibrant colors, the lagoon filled with flamingos and pelicans, the elephants, zebras, buffalo, lions, hippos, and ostriches&#8230; and the \u00abbig one\u00bb we had yet to see: the rhinoceros\u2014truly impressive.<\/span><\/em><\/p>\n<p><em><span style=\"font-family: arial, helvetica, sans-serif; color: #800000; font-size: 14pt;\">We loved the hotels where we stayed; they were perfect. We wrapped up the trip in Zanzibar, a true paradise. We snorkeled on the reef near Mnemba Island and in the Blue Lagoon on the island&#8217;s east coast, strolled along incredible beaches, and witnessed dramatic tidal shifts and dreamlike sunsets. We enjoyed every last minute of the trip\u2014it was perfect.<\/span><\/em><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: arial, helvetica, sans-serif; color: #800000; font-size: 12pt;\">The Vigo Family (Madrid) \u2013 May 2026<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<div class=\"testimonials_slider_item_header\">\n<hgroup>\n<h5 style=\"text-align: center;\"><a href=\"http: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\"><span style=\"color: #800000; font-family: arial, helvetica, sans-serif;\">www.nyalatours.com<\/span><\/a><\/h5>\n<h5><\/h5>\n<\/hgroup>\n<h5><a href=\"http: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-13392 aligncenter\" src=\"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Tanzania-1-300x300.png\" alt=\"\" width=\"650\" height=\"650\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Tanzania-1-300x300.png 300w, https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Tanzania-1-1024x1024.png 1024w, https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Tanzania-1-150x150.png 150w, https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Tanzania-1-768x768.png 768w, https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Tanzania-1.png 1200w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 650px) 100vw, 650px\" \/><\/a><\/h5>\n<\/div>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>La Familia Vigo comparte su experiencia viajando a Tanzania y Zanz\u00edbar con Nyala Tours en mayo de 2026: safari en Tarangire, lago Manyara, Serengeti y Ngorongoro, con final de viaje en las playas de Zanz\u00edbar.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":13393,"comment_status":"closed","ping_status":"closed","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"_acf_changed":false,"footnotes":""},"categories":[82],"tags":[702,701,699,695,535,402,5,700,698,697,284,225],"class_list":["post-13391","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-opiniones-clientes","tag-isla-mnemba","tag-lago-manyara","tag-ngorongoro","tag-safari-en-tanzania","tag-safari-y-playa","tag-serengeti","tag-tanzania","tag-tarangire","tag-testimonios-nyala-tours","tag-viajes-a-africa","tag-viajes-a-medida","tag-zanzibar"],"acf":[],"aioseo_notices":[],"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/13391","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/1"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/comments?post=13391"}],"version-history":[{"count":4,"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/13391\/revisions"}],"predecessor-version":[{"id":13395,"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/13391\/revisions\/13395"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/13393"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=13391"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=13391"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.nyalatours.com\/blog\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=13391"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
